Last Updated at 11 October 2024UMS Kernpur: A Detailed Look at a Bihar Primary School
UMS Kernpur, a government-run primary school in Bihar, India, offers a glimpse into the educational landscape of rural India. Established in 1956 under the Department of Education, this co-educational institution serves students from Class 1 to Class 8, providing a crucial foundation for their academic journey. The school's location in the Barsoi block of Katihar district places it within a rural setting, highlighting its role in providing education to children in a less-accessible area.
The school's infrastructure comprises a government building, featuring 10 classrooms in good condition, suggesting a reasonable capacity for its student body. The presence of a playground provides a vital space for recreational activities and physical development, contributing positively to the students' overall well-being. While the school lacks a library and computer-aided learning facilities, its functional hand pumps offer a reliable source of drinking water for students and staff.
The teaching staff consists of a dedicated team of eight teachers—six male and two female—demonstrating a commitment to providing quality education to the students. The school operates with Hindi as its medium of instruction, aligning with the local language and fostering better understanding among students. The provision of midday meals, prepared and served on the school premises, ensures that students receive adequate nutrition, supporting their academic performance and overall health.
